ELL and Siemens: framework agreement for 200 Vectrons

Locomotives will be provided in various power system variants for use in both passenger and freight service.


European Locomotive Leasing Group (ELL) and Siemens Mobility have signed a framework agreement for the supply of up to 200 additional Vectron locomotives. Sixty locomotives have been ordered initially and will be delivered successively from 2025. By 2027, ELL will have at least 301 Siemens Vectron locomotives in service, making it the largest Vectron fleet in Europe. In the medium term, the new agreement offers ELL the possibility of increasing its Vectron fleet to more than 400 locomotives.

In the framework agreement, ELL secures the procurement of a wide range of multi-system locomotives, including the Vectron Dual Mode. It was also agreed that Siemens Mobility would actively support ELL in further strengthening its competence in vehicle operation, maintenance and repair.

Since the first delivery in 2012, more than 2,200 locomotives from the Vectron family have been sold to 95 customers and the fleet has clocked up more than 850 million kilometres. The locomotives are currently approved for operation in 20 European countries.
